What is the relevance of this prac…?

The prac brings together several concepts that underpin many areas of chemistry study. You will undertake your first laboratory synthesis in which you make a compound (much like cooking but you don’t get to lick the bowl!).

You will then analyse, using Le Châtelier’s Principle, how the reaction conditions may be optimised in order to maximise the amount of product you obtain. Le Châtelier’s Principle can be used to predict outcomes on a small scale such as your reaction vessel, on a miniscule scale such as in cells and on a planetary scale such as in Earth’s atmosphere.

Finally, you will examine how the charge of a species determines what solvents it can be

dissolved in. The type of possible intermolecular forces present between the solute and solvent

will dictate solubility and this is investigated during this practical. Intermolecular forces are

incredibly important and we take them for granted all the time. They are responsible for oxygen

being a gas at room temperature so we can breathe it in and water being a liquid at room

temperature so we can drink it.

Introduction (extra background)

CO-ORDINATION COMPLEXES

This experiment involves the synthesis and investigation of a co-ordination complex:

tris(acetylacetonato) iron (III). Co-ordination complexes are a class of compounds that most

commonly involve a central metal ion which is surrounded by a certain number of molecules or

ions called ligands. These ligands are said to “co-ordinate” to the metal centre and therefore

the bond formed between them is referred to as a co-ordinate bond.
